Novacare Shreveport - Hours & Locations

1

Novacare - Shreveport

820 Jordan St, Ste 370, Shreveport LA 71101 Phone Number:(318) 221-7055
  1. Store Hours

Hours may fluctuate

Distance:1.79 miles
Edit